  • Patent number: 8371366
    Abstract: An evaporator 1 is configured such that two heat exchange tube groups 16, each composed of a plurality of heat exchange tubes 15, are provided between a pair of header tanks 2, 3, while being separated from each other in a front-rear direction. Each of the header tanks 2, 3 includes two header sections 5, 6, 11, 12. Each header tank 2, 3 includes a first member 21, 93 to which the heat exchange tubes 15 are connected, and a second member 22, 94 which is joined to the first member 21, 93 and covers the side of the first member 21, 93 opposite the heat exchange tubes 15. Partition portions 41, 42 for dividing the interiors of the header section 5, 6, 11, 12 into upper and lower spaces 5a, 5b, 6a, 6b are provided on the second member 22, 94 of the header tank 2, 3. Through holes 47, 51A, 101, 102 for establishing communication between the upper and lower spaces 5a, 5b, 6a, 6b of the header section 5, 6, 11, 12 are formed in the partition portions 41, 42.

  • Patent number: 8146652
    Abstract: A heat exchanger used as an evaporator is configured such that two heat exchange tube groups, each composed of a plurality of heat exchange tubes, are provided between a pair of header tanks, while being separated from each other in a front-rear direction. Each of the header tanks includes two header sections. Each header tank includes a first member to which the heat exchange tubes are connected, a second member which is joined to the first member and covers the side of the first member opposite the heat exchange tubes, and a partition plate disposed between the first and second members and having partition portions which divide the interiors of the two header sections into respective upper and lower spaces. Through holes are formed in the partition portions so as to establish communication between the upper and lower spaces of the header sections.

  • Publication number: 20070251681
    Abstract: A corrugate fin of an evaporator includes wave crest portions, wave trough portions, and flat connection portions connecting together the wave crest portions and the wave trough portions. Opposite end portions of a cutout extend to corresponding connection portions located at opposite ends of the wave crest portion and the wave trough portion. A projection projecting inward is formed integrally with end portions of the connection portions, the end portions of the connection portions corresponding to opposite ends of the cutout. The projection extends between the end portions of the connection portions located at the opposite ends of the wave crest portion and the wave trough portion. The projection projects inward in a shape resembling a lying letter V. The evaporator exhibits excellent drainage of condensed water and enables high work efficiency in manufacture thereof.
